Call of Duty: Black Ops – 7 million copies sold the first day!
Many predicted Call of Duty: Black Ops big sales, but whatever happened to that! On VGChartz writes that according to preliminary estimates, Activision sold 7,000,000 boxes of the game on the first day of sales.

The situation in the regions of the world as follows: 3.6 million copies of Call of Duty: Black Ops sold in America, 1.4 million – in the UK, nearly 1 million – in Europe and 350 000 copies in Canada.
Xbox 360 has the largest share of sales – 59% of PS3 – 36% balance on PC, Wii and DS on interest not even considered. If the information is correct, the Black Ops was the best-selling project in the world in the history of video games.
